From: Isaku Yamahata <isaku.yamahata@xxxxxxxxx> Implement TDG.VP.VMCALL<GetTdVmCallInfo> hypercall. If the input value is zero, return success code and zero in output registers. TDG.VP.VMCALL<GetTdVmCallInfo> hypercall is a subleaf of TDG.VP.VMCALL to enumerate which TDG.VP.VMCALL sub leaves are supported. This hypercall is for future enhancement of the Guest-Host-Communication Interface (GHCI) specification. The GHCI version of 344426-001US defines it to require input R12 to be zero and to return zero in output registers, R11, R12, R13, and R14 so that guest TD enumerates no enhancement.
